Job Responsibilities:
- Support the planning, delivery, and management of housing development projects.
- Assist in identifying opportunities for new housing developments and funding.
- Prepare reports, proposals, and presentations for internal and external stakeholders.
- Monitor project progress and ensure compliance with policies, procedures, and regulations.
- Liaise with colleagues, contractors, and partners to ensure projects are delivered on time and within budget.
- Contribute to housing strategy development and implementation.
Person Specification:
Must-Have Requirements:- Eligibility to work in the UK.
- Experience in housing development or related sector.
- Strong organisational and project management skills.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
- Knowledge of local housing policies and planning regulations.
- Experience in preparing funding applications or business cases.
- Understanding of the housing development lifecycle.

How to prepare for a job interview at i-Jobs
✨Know Your Housing Development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of housing development and local policies. Familiarise yourself with the housing development lifecycle and any recent projects in the area. This will show that you're not just interested in the role, but that you understand the context in which you'll be working.
✨Prepare Your Success Stories
Think of specific examples from your past experience that highlight your project management skills and ability to work with stakeholders. Be ready to discuss how you've successfully delivered projects on time and within budget, as this is crucial for the role.
✨Practice Your Communication Skills
Since excellent written and verbal communication skills are a must-have, practice articulating your thoughts clearly. You might even want to prepare a short presentation on a relevant topic to demonstrate your ability to communicate effectively during the interview.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are some thoughtful questions to ask at the end of your interview. This could be about the current housing strategy or upcoming projects. It sh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
